Output 44bcba71a326a5ef622ca4b6245f0132a69f767b1a7a8f9b6ce1368c15b63c68:0

value
18975191
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ec703d4de69a60a3189c83853e2bcdf8a2fa543b OP_EQUALVERIFY OP_CHECKSIG
address
1NZAvooyQ7SAmAaJQT5NGRTYRra7j8k63E
transaction
44bcba71a326a5ef622ca4b6245f0132a69f767b1a7a8f9b6ce1368c15b63c68
spent
true